What Is Nonsurgical Fat Reduction?

Nonsurgical fat reduction encompasses a variety of treatments designed to eliminate stubborn fat deposits without resorting to surgery. These methods target specific body areas, employing various technologies such as cooling, ultrasound, and laser to break down fatty tissues. The attraction of these nonsurgical options lies in their ability to offer a less risky and more comfortable alternative to traditional liposuction. Historically, invasive surgery was the only choice for body contouring, but technological advancements have paved the way for safer, noninvasive solutions that many people are now opting for.

Popular Nonsurgical Techniques

Several innovative techniques dominate the realm of nonsurgical fat reduction. Chief among these are cryolipolysis, laser lipolysis, and ultrasound fat reduction. Cryolipolysis, often called “fat freezing,” uses precise cooling to freeze and eliminate fat cells. On the other hand, laser lipolysis utilizes targeted laser energy to disrupt fat deposits. Lastly, ultrasound fat reduction employs sound waves to achieve similar fat-breaking effects. How Effective Are These Procedures?

The effectiveness of nonsurgical fat reduction methods varies based on individual attributes and the specific technology. However, many clinical studies and anecdotal evidence suggest that these procedures can significantly reduce fatty tissue in targeted areas. Results may vary, but some individuals experience up to a 25% reduction in fat layer thickness following a cycle of treatments. A key factor in achieving optimal results is maintaining realistic expectations and understanding that such procedures often serve best as an adjunct to a healthy lifestyle rather than a substitute for weight loss. What to Expect During and After the Procedure

Undergoing a nonsurgical fat reduction session is generally a comfortable, straightforward experience. The procedure can last 30 minutes to an hour, depending on the technology. Patients might encounter sensations such as cooling, warmth, or tingling during the treatment, but these are typically mild and non-invasive. Post-treatment, some individuals report temporary redness, swelling, or tenderness in the treated area; however, these symptoms usually dissipate shortly. For optimal results, patients should follow post-treatment care guidelines provided by their healthcare provider and integrate routine physical activity and balanced nutrition into their daily lives.
